How is a cocoon formed?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

1. The fully grown caterpillars of silkworm stop feeding and secretes a sticky fluid through their silk gland.
2. The secreted fluid comes out through spinneret and lakes the form of long fine thread of silk which hardens on exposure to air and is wrapped around the body of caterpillar in the forms of a covering called as cocoon.
